“You’re Making that Face Again”, by Jerry Scott and Jim Borgman

Scott, Jerry. You’re Making That Face Again: Zits Sketchbook 13. Kansas City, MO: Andrews McMeel Pub., 2010. Print.

My son picked this up at the library, and when I saw it in the living room I grabbed it up to glance through.  I have to say I enjoyed it a lot – there is a surprising depth and subtlety to the “Zits” depiction of teenage-dom that I’d forgotten about.  Fortunately this 13-year-old of mine doesn’t (yet?) shut me out of his thoughts, and I hope we can continue to jointly laugh at things that might hit a little close to home.
